> > > Do we have an _actual_ use case where PSCI node is not at at root node? 
> > 
> > Yes, many cases, because it belongs as well to firmware node.
> > 
> 
> +1, I was about to make similar comment. /psci predates the formal push
> to put all firmware related nodes under /firmware, so /firmware/psci is
> equally possible path and should be recommended one so that all such
> firmware related nodes are contained under /firmware.
